Perceptual Three-Dimensional (3D) Video Coding Based on Depth Information
First Claim
1. A method for encoding a multi-view frame in a video encoder, wherein the multi-view frame comprises a plurality of two-dimensional (2D) frames, the method comprising:
- computing a depth quality sensitivity measure for a multi-view coding block in the multi-view frame;
computing a depth-based perceptual quantization scale for a 2D coding block of the multi-view coding block, wherein the depth-based perceptual quantization scale is based on the depth quality sensitive measure and a base quantization scale for the 2D frame including the 2D coding block; and
encoding the 2D coding block using the depth-based perceptual quantization scale.
0 Assignments
0 Petitions
Accused Products
Abstract
A method for encoding a multi-view frame in a video encoder is provided that includes computing a depth quality sensitivity measure for a multi-view coding block in the multi-view frame, computing a depth-based perceptual quantization scale for a 2D coding block of the multi-view coding block, wherein the depth-based perceptual quantization scale is based on the depth quality sensitive measure and a base quantization scale for the 2D frame including the 2D coding block, and encoding the 2D coding block using the depth-based perceptual quantization scale.
-
Citations
20 Claims
-
1. A method for encoding a multi-view frame in a video encoder, wherein the multi-view frame comprises a plurality of two-dimensional (2D) frames, the method comprising:
-
computing a depth quality sensitivity measure for a multi-view coding block in the multi-view frame; computing a depth-based perceptual quantization scale for a 2D coding block of the multi-view coding block, wherein the depth-based perceptual quantization scale is based on the depth quality sensitive measure and a base quantization scale for the 2D frame including the 2D coding block; and encoding the 2D coding block using the depth-based perceptual quantization scale.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. An apparatus configured to perform video encoding of a multi-view frame, wherein the multi-view frame comprises a plurality of two-dimensional (2D) frames, the apparatus comprising:
-
means for computing a depth quality sensitivity measure for a multi-view coding block in the multi-view frame; means for computing a depth-based perceptual quantization scale for a 2D coding block of the multi-view coding block, wherein the depth-based perceptual quantization scale is based on the depth quality sensitive measure and a base quantization scale for the 2D frame including the 2D coding block; and means for encoding the 2D coding block using the depth-based perceptual quantization scale.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A non-transitory computer-readable medium storing software instructions that, when executed by a processor, perform a method for encoding a multi-view frame, wherein the multi-view frame comprises a plurality of two-dimensional (2D) frames, the method comprising:
-
computing a depth quality sensitivity measure for a multi-view coding block in the multi-view frame; computing a depth-based perceptual quantization scale for a 2D coding block of the multi-view coding block, wherein the depth-based perceptual quantization scale is based on the depth quality sensitive measure and a base quantization scale for the 2D frame including the 2D coding block; and encoding the 2D coding block using the depth-based perceptual quantization scale. - View Dependent Claims (20)
-
Specification